SHILLONG, Sep 5: Chief Secretary Donald Philip Wahlang will retire from service on September 30.
A notification issued by the state government said that on attaining the age of superannuation, Chief Secretary DP Wahlang, a 1993 batch IAS Officer, will retire from government service with effect from September 30.
Wahlang took over as the Chief Secretary of Meghalaya on August 1, 2022, succeeding Rebecca V. Suchiang.
Additional Chief Secretary Shakil P. Ahammed is likely to succeed Wahlang as the next Chief Secretary of Meghalaya.
